Where does “schussbereit” come from?

schussbereit (German) comes from German Schuss, from Middle High German schuz, from Middle High German schützen, from Proto-Germanic skutjaną, from Proto-Germanic skuttą, from Proto-Indo-European (s)kewd- — to advance, push; to drive, propel.

schussbereit (German): ready to shoot or take a photograph

Definitions

  1. ready to shoot or take a photograph
